Step-by-step explanation:
Electricity consumption by the residents in a local community is normally distributed, with a mean of 32 kilowatt-hours per day.
We have that, 95% of the residents use between 28 and 36 kilowatt-hours per day.
According to the empirical rule , 95% of the distribution falls within two standard deviations of the mean.
We can use the upper x=36, and the mean,
to find the standard deviation using the formula:
We substitute to get:
Therefore the standard deviation is 2.
